The only real issue I have is the fact they switched out the Orchestral DQ Opening Theme that even the Switch had to a lower quality 16-bit(?) version, its extremely jarring and noticeable during the opening cinematic as it also removes ALL the sound effects.

Otherwise, its a much better version overall. No more needing to carry a spare set of equipment in case something breaks, every bit of equipment is infinite durability.
Slightly higher starting HP, not much of a difference really, but a bit better for the early game if you want to try and cheese some of the field bosses in the first area before hunger or time activates (to note, both only become active after one of the intro quests).
A full digit higher for max stackable inventory items.
Plus every DLC including whatever the mobile and console versions got.

It's not as long as it's sequel, roughly about a quarter the time maybe? But the real meat is the Terra Incognita anyway, to unlock and just build whatever. Build height has been buffed too.
